【如何倒计时关机命令】在日常使用电脑的过程中,用户有时需要设置一个倒计时自动关机的功能,比如在完成文件下载、程序运行后自动关机,以节省电力或避免长时间开机。不同操作系统提供了不同的命令来实现这一功能。下面将对Windows和Linux系统中的倒计时关机命令进行总结,并通过表格形式展示。
一、Windows 系统倒计时关机命令
在Windows中,可以使用`shutdown`命令来设置倒计时关机。该命令支持多种参数,可根据需求灵活调整。
| 命令 | 功能说明 |
| `shutdown -s -t 60` | 60秒后关机 |
| `shutdown -s -t 3600` | 1小时后关机 |
| `shutdown -a` | 取消已计划的关机 |
| `shutdown -r -t 60` | 60秒后重启 |
| `shutdown -l` | 注销当前用户(不适用于关机) |
注意事项:
- 执行命令前需确保有管理员权限。
- 如果希望取消关机,可在倒计时结束前执行`shutdown -a`命令。
二、Linux 系统倒计时关机命令
在Linux系统中,可以使用`shutdown`或`sleep`配合`poweroff`或`reboot`命令来实现倒计时关机。
| 命令 | 功能说明 |
| `sudo shutdown -h +10` | 10分钟后关机 |
| `sudo shutdown -r +5` | 5分钟后重启 |
| `sudo poweroff` | 立即关机 |
| `sudo reboot` | 立即重启 |
| `sleep 3600 && sudo poweroff` | 1小时后关机(适用于脚本) |
注意事项:
- 需要使用`sudo`获取管理员权限。
- `+n`表示n分钟后执行操作,`now`表示立即执行。
三、总结对比
| 操作系统 | 倒计时关机命令 | 说明 |
| Windows | `shutdown -s -t n` | n为秒数,`-s`表示关机 |
| Windows | `shutdown -r -t n` | `-r`表示重启 |
| Linux | `sudo shutdown -h +n` | `+n`表示n分钟后关机 |
| Linux | `sudo shutdown -r +n` | `+n`表示n分钟后重启 |
| Linux | `sleep n && sudo poweroff` | 通过脚本实现延迟关机 |
通过以上方法,用户可以根据自身需求选择合适的命令来实现倒计时关机功能。无论是Windows还是Linux系统,掌握这些基础命令都能提高工作效率并更好地管理设备电源。


